A South Carolina driver died in a single-car accident on Friday morning. What we know:

One person was killed in a Friday morning wreck in Aiken County.

According to a release from the Aiken County Coroner’s Office, officers responded to the crash on Wire Road near Uncle Duck Road around 7:15 a.m. Friday. An investigation revealed that a 1994 Acura sedan was driving north on the 3000 block of Wire Road when it left the road, overturned, and ejected the driver.

The coroner’s office identified the driver as 29-year-old Ke’Lonte Stanley. The coroner’s office confirmed that he died at the scene.

The South Carolina Highway Patrol and the Aiken County Coroner’s Office are still investigating the incident.
